Description The House of Hanover. King George II Reign, 1727-1760. 1758 Sixpence. Obverse: Older laureate and draped bust of King George II left. Engraver: John Tanner. Legend: GEORGIUS·II· DEI·GRATIA· (George the Second by the Grace of God.) Reverse: Crowned cruciform shields around central Garter star, divided date above. Engraver: Johann Ochs. Legend: M·B·F·ET H·REX·F·D·B ET·L·D·S·R·I A·T·ET·E·17 57· (King of Great Britain, France and Ireland, Defender of the Faith, Duke of Brunswick and Lueneburg, Arch Treasurer and Elector of the Holy Roman Empire). Catalogue: Spink# 3711, KM# 582. Silver, 0.925, 0.0895 oz. ASW, 3.0100g, 21mm. Grade: aVF.
